SunState Medical Specialists (SMS), part of OneOncology, delivers exceptional, community-based specialty care across Florida. With a team of 105 physicians spanning urology, radiation oncology, medical oncology, breast surgery, general surgery, and head and neck surgery, SMS is committed to providing high-quality, accessible care. Our practice offers advanced radiation therapies, in-house pharmacy and laboratory capabilities, care management, theranostics, cutting-edge diagnostic imaging, and clinical research.

About the role

The Office Manager oversees the business operations of the assigned medical practice and supervises the support staff of that practice.

Responsibilities

  • Hire and train office staff. Provide training and insight on policies, procedures, and billing systems.
  • Manage staff schedules to maximize efficiency and effectiveness.
  • Understand and implement all policies and procedures including regulatory compliance.
  • Ensure that patient records are accurate and complete, and that patient confidentiality is strictly maintained.
  • Coordinate with payer contracting and credentialing teams to oversee the maintenance of all physician licenses, CMEs, and other documents required for the physician(s) to practice.
  • Responsible for monitoring of code capture and collections for practice.
  • Coordinate and assist the Director of Operations with the financial aspects of the business unit including accounts payable, inventory control, and accounts receivable.
  • Responsible for Physician scheduling and on-call coverage.
  • Oversee facility maintenance, operations issues, and coordination of third-party vendors.
  • Order office supplies and materials for office(s).
  • Act as a liaison between office(s) and Support Center. Work cross-functionally with various departments such as Compliance, HR, and Billing to ensure company objectives are met.
  • Maintain attendance according to scheduled days and hours, appropriate dress and appearance standards, and attend mandatory company training sessions as required by state/federal law.
  • Responsible for site visits throughout the region.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by Physicians or Director of Operations.
